Down Among the Dead Men is a dark underworld thriller from bestselling crime writer, Kerry Wilkinson. 'I'm going to do you a favour: I'm going to tell you my name and then I'm going to give you thirty seconds to turn and run. If any of you are still here after those thirty seconds, then we're going to have a problem'. Jason Green's life is changed for good after he is saved from a mugging by crime boss, Harry Irwell. He is then drawn into Manchester's notorious underworld, where smash and grab is as normal as making a cup of tea. But Jason isn't a casual thug. He has a life plan that doesn't involve blowing his money on the usual trappings. That is until a woman walks into his life offering the one thing that money can't buy - salvation.
This book kick's off with a young Jason Green, and life as it is for him. He is rescued from a good kicking by Crime boss, Harry Irwell.
It then fast forwards to Jason now. and the life he is living. He seem's quite an ordinary guy, doesn't like to stand out, doesn't like attention. Despite seeming quite ordinary he is very much playing at being one of the big boy's. Where robbery just seem's as normal as going to work for the day. We shoot from past to present in this book, which gives you good background on the characters. Despite what they do, I did like a few of the character. And Jason seemed like someone that everyone could know, that guy who doesn't really stand out, the one you think is quiet, the one you think just goes home and chills out of an evening. There seemed to be quite a bit of background and getting to know Jason, which I liked. I just felt that the start of this book was a little slow at taking off. However once it took off it took off I really got into in. The story was interesting and certainly kept me reading, I read this book pretty quick. And did enjoy it. It was a little different to what I have previously read by Kerry, but still a really good, interesting read. Biography
Despite two national newspaper reports to the contrary, Kerry Wilkinson is male. Honestly. His debut, LOCKED IN, the first in the detective Jessica Daniel series, is a UK no.1 Kindle bestseller, with the first three Jessica Daniel books making him Amazon UK's top-selling author for the final quarter of 2011. THINK OF THE CHILDREN outsold Dan Brown to become Amazon UK's no.1 Kindle pre-order. Kerry is the first formerly self-published British author to have an ebook no.1 and reach the top 20 of the UK paperback chart. Since then, the Jessica Daniel series has continued with PLAYING WITH FIRE, THICKER THAN WATER, BEHIND CLOSED DOORS, CROSSING THE LINE and SCARRED FOR LIFE. A spin-off from PLAYING WITH FIRE - the Andrew Hunter series - started with SOMETHING WICKED in 2014. The follow-up, SOMETHING HIDDEN, will be released in 2016. A standalone crime novel, DOWN AMONG THE DEAD MEN, set in the same world as Jessica and Andrew, will be released in October 2015. Pan Macmillan - Griffin in the US - are also publishing Kerry's young adult/fantasy/adventure series - the Silver Blackthorn trilogy. The first book, RECKONING, was released in 2014, with RENEGADE following in 2015 and RESURGENCE in 2016. He is an occasional sports journalist and can frequently be spotted cycling the hills of Lancashire. He was born in Somerset but now lives in the north west.
